About Drummoyne 2047

The size of Drummoyne is approximately 2.3 square kilometres. It has 19 parks covering nearly 9.5% of total area. The population of Drummoyne in 2011 was 11,377 people. By 2016 the population was 11,946 showing a population growth of 5.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Drummoyne is 30-39 years. Households in Drummoyne are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Drummoyne work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 61.6% of the homes in Drummoyne were owner-occupied compared with 59.8% in 2016.

Drummoyne has 7,153 properties.
